Cost Engineer

Parker Hannifin, a global supplier of EMI shielding and thermal interface materials, is seeking a Cost Engineer to develop cost estimates and product structures for new and existing products. The role involves cross-functional collaboration with various departments to support part and tooling design and manage production release activities.

Responsibilities

Develop timely, accurate cost estimates and technical data for new and existing products
Create and maintain product structures, item masters, and PDM Bills of Material; ensure traceability from prototype to production
Evaluate customer RFQs for manufacturing feasibility and quality implications; provide cost inputs for quotations (meet Quote P75 SLA)
Define manufacturing methods and collaborate on tooling specification/design (dies, fixtures, jigs, inspection tooling)
Ensure Engineering Change Order (ECO) and Management of Change (MOC) processes are followed before updating BOMs and item masters
Support production release activities and manage New Part Orders to meet ship dates
Review material, equipment, tooling, and labor usage to achieve target cost/price
Act as technical liaison with customers and suppliers; provide guidance on design concepts to best utilize division capabilities
Assist in preparing production drawings and documentation to industry standards (ANSI, CES)
Manage multiple concurrent projects; coordinate with Planners, Process, Quality, Tool Shop, and Manufacturing
Provide advice on technical and cost issues and contribute to cross‑functional project teams
